What does the p0037 code on a catalytic converter mean?
The P0037 code is set when the ECM detects that the HO2S2 on bank 1 has a malfunctioning heater element. The heater in the oxygen sensor helps get the sensor up to operating temperature faster in order to improve fuel economy and emissions. This O2 sensor is located after the catalytic converter and monitors the catalytic converter’s efficiency.

What does the p0037 code on a Nissan mean?
Water getting inside the heated oxygen sensor connector can caused the heated oxygen sensor fuse to blow, which is a very common problem for this type codes. Before replacing the sensor, check for the condition of the heated oxygen sensor fuse and connectors. The cost to diagnose the P0037 NISSAN code is 1.0 hour of labor.

What causes a trouble code p0037 on an oxygen sensor?
Potential causes of a P0037 trouble code may include: Bank 1, sensor #2 oxygen sensor heater element has failed Physical damage to heated oxygen sensor has occurred Control circuit (or voltage feed, depending on system) is shorted to ground PCM Oxygen sensor heater driver has failed
